GTIN exempt but still can't list without product ID (FIXED)

Hi, so I applied for GTIN exemption for my products, which are lights and was approved. The only category I could select which leads to lighting on the amazon store was ‘Home & Garden’, so this is the category I chose to be exempt in. However, when trying to add a product on amazon seller central, there is no ‘Home & Garden’ category, instead it’s ‘Home & Kitchen’. I don’t know if this difference in category is the issue, but the product ID box is still there, no matter which category I select and I still cannot save and list my products without putting info in the GTIN field. I am putting my brand name into the correct field, which is the same as was approved for exemption.

My exemption status was approved and I received email confirmation which said:

‘NOTE: Please leave the ‘Product ID’ section blank while listing. Provide all information in the ‘Vital Info’ tab and ‘Offer’ tab. Once completed, please click on the ‘Save and Finish’ button that will be highlighted at the bottom of the screen. If you receive an error indicating that Amazon should approve the brand, please contact us via the contact us form with the brand name that you used when creating the listing along with a screenshot of the error.’

I cannot leave the product ID section blank because it is a required field. Any ideas?

EDIT: I figured it out. For some reason choosing ‘Lighting’ or any other sub category within ‘Home & Kitchen’ was a problem. I had to choose ‘Other (Home & Kitchen)’ in order for the product ID field to be missing from my listing and my exemption to work.
